Comprehensive Guide to Allergy Action Plan

What is the Food Allergy Action Plan?

The Food Allergy Action Plan is a crucial document in healthcare settings that helps manage food allergy emergencies. This form outlines the necessary steps to take when a student experiences an allergic reaction, ensuring comprehensive support is available. Key components of the form include vital student information and specific allergy details, emphasizing its role in enhancing safety in schools and other environments where food allergies can pose a risk.

Purpose and Benefits of the Food Allergy Action Plan

The primary purpose of the Food Allergy Action Plan is to safeguard student health by outlining emergency preparedness strategies. For parents and guardians, having a documented plan means they can manage allergies effectively, ensuring prompt action is taken in case of a food allergy crisis. This plan is beneficial not just for students, but also for school personnel who need clarity on how to react swiftly in emergencies involving allergic reactions.

Key Features of the Food Allergy Action Plan

This action plan includes various form fields designed to collect essential information. Users will find sections to complete for the student's name, grade, date of birth, and details about their allergies. Additionally, the form features signature lines for both healthcare providers and parents/guardians, validating the information provided. Customizable fillable fields enhance usability across various situations to ensure thorough preparation for any food allergy emergencies.

Who Needs the Food Allergy Action Plan?

The Food Allergy Action Plan is intended for parents, guardians, and healthcare providers who support students with food allergies. Given the critical nature of allergies in school settings, it is essential that all students with known food allergies have this document on file. School health staff must maintain these records to help ensure a safe environment for all students.
